(713) 839-0020

Database updated 9 hours ago 1 match found associated with this phone number
Address History: 19866 Po Box, Sugar Land, TX 77496; 611 Congress Avenue, Austin, TX 78701; Bellaire, TX 77402; Houston, TX 77292

Results 1 - 1 of 1